Area: D&IT Strategy & Governance.

Scope of role

The ideal profile is proactive, has a good knowledge of IT organization and of software lifecycle and has a strong competence in software Productivity measurement. Part of the D&IT Strategy and Governance area, the resource will join the Vendor Management and Productivity Office team. He/She will be responsible of Productivity office management and all related activities. Those includes the setup of Productivity framework for new Suppliers and new contracts, and the management of Productivity measurement on contract already in place. To manage all these activities the Productivity Manager will coordinate a Vodafone offshore team that will carry on operative tasks.

Main task

  • Management of Productivity measurement of main IT Suppliers.
  • Coordination of Productivity COE (Vodafone offshore team in charge of operativity).
  • Productivity measurement framework setup for new Suppliers.
  • Executive reports and dashboard to be presented to the Management.
  • Support the negotiation of contracts to include Productivity measurement.

Competencies, knowledge and experience

  • IFPUG Certified. Other competencies will be considered too (e.g. Gartner).
  • At least 2 years of experience in IT Productivity measurement.
  • Ability to work multitasking, very good analytical skills, problem solving and decision making are core skills for this role.
  • English professional proficiency.
  • Very good relational skills.

Must have competences

  • Excellent knowledge of Excel and Power Point.
  • IFPUG certification or similar.
  • Power BI is a plus.

Studies

  • Economic or Engineering master degree.

Preferred location: Milano.
